Wildfire Mapping with Sentinel-2 satellite mision data

Every year an area of 350 million hectares is affected by fire, of which 90% are forest fires. With economic losses, fires can result in human and animal losses and cause damage to health and the environment that cannot be fully compensated. Therefore, it is necessary to detect fires more efficiently, reliable and faster, and also to improve fire management and analyse affected areas. Remote sensing methods can provide a quick and efficient response to this problem and can provide better estimates and fire detection. Today, remote sensing methods are most commonly used in the post-fire management for the wildfire maps production, which can contribute to strategies for preventing, predicting, mitigating and better response to fire. By developing new systems, such as the European Copernicus program, the application of these methods has become publicly available in full extant with no charge. This paper presents the wildfire map making procedure for the Makarska Riviera area in the Republic of Croatia based on Sentinel-2 satellite data and open source software using the normalized burned ratio (NBR) technique. Except for improving fire management and obtaining information on location and extent of damage, this procedure also allows monitoring the recovery of the affected environment
